When worry won't switch off

Persistent anxiety can show up as constant worry, racing thoughts, restlessness, trouble sleeping, irritability, or physical tension that doesn't ease. For many people, therapy and medication help meaningfully. For others, symptoms remain difficult to manage day to day.

If standard approaches haven't given you enough relief, it may be worth exploring a treatment that works differently. A consultation lets you talk this through with a medical provider and understand whether IV ketamine is a reasonable option for your situation.

A calm, clinician-guided approach

A different mechanism

Ketamine acts on the glutamate system rather than the pathways most anti-anxiety medications target.

A window for change

Some patients find ketamine creates space in which therapy and coping skills become easier to engage.

Monitored comfort

Vital signs are monitored throughout each session in a calm, private, supportive environment.

Because anxiety can shape how the experience feels, we take time to prepare you and to make the setting as comfortable as possible — a quiet room, an eye mask, and attentive monitoring throughout.

What treatment may involve

Protocols are individualized. Many patients begin with a short series of infusions and then assess, with their provider, whether occasional maintenance sessions are helpful.

Ketamine is a medical treatment, not a replacement for therapy. For many people it works best alongside psychotherapy and ongoing care. Results vary, and treatment is recommended only after a clinical evaluation.
